📖 Key Information

Grasmoor at 852m (2,795ft) is the highest and most massive of the North Western Fells, a great dome of a mountain above Crummock Water that Wainwright described as one of the finest viewpoints in the district — the panorama from Grasmoor's summit takes in the full sweep of the northern and western fells, with the two great lakes of Crummock Water and Buttermere gleaming in the valley far below. The steep south-east ridge from Lanthwaite Green is the classic ascent, offering dramatic views as height is gained. The ridge traverse to Eel Crag and Sail makes for one of the finest full-day circuits in the North Western group.

🚌 Buses from Penrith / Ambleside / Windermere

Stagecoach 77 / 77A “Honister Rambler”
Keswick – Portinscale – Hawse End (Catbells) – Grange – Seatoller – Honister Pass – Buttermere – Lorton – Whinlatter – Keswick (circular)
Catch it from: Keswick (connect via 555 from Windermere/Ambleside or X4/X5 from Penrith)
Seasonal (roughly Easter–October). Brilliant for the North Western fells: Catbells, Dale Head from Honister, the Buttermere fells and Whinlatter.

Rural routes change seasonally — confirm on stagecoachbus.com or Traveline before relying on a last bus.
